Transaction ffaca37e9a38e3838d7a4dfa1558f8578ea9563f413f109c9d16058d7430b583
1 Input
1 Output
-
ffaca37e9a38e3838d7a4dfa1558f8578ea9563f413f109c9d16058d7430b583:0
- value
- 938790
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 070569ca79fb566715ff7210f8271198f9762c53 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1e8DTnF2Dtz3W3ue47pBtWbYK2bHBKyi5